Sugi-no-Osugi Japanese cedar
This giant cedar tree is estimated to be 3,000 years old. The tree is called "meoto sugi," as it is two trees (north cedar and south cedar) connected at the root.
It is believed that visitors to the tree can fulfill their wishes,as a female singer once prayed for vocal skills and later became one of Japan's best singers.
